ZAGREB – The Ministry of Demography, Family, Youth, and Social Policy, in cooperation with the National Foundation for Civil Society Development and the Ministry of Labor and Pension System, is organizing informational workshops as part of the Call for Project Proposal Submission “Support for Youth-Oriented Programs” within the Operational Program “Efficient Human Resources” 2014-2020 (11 AM, Congress Center Forum, Radnička cesta 50). The workshop will be opened by the Minister of Demography, Family, Youth, and Social Policy Nada Murganić. The total value of the call is 12 million kuna, and the informational workshops are intended for potential applicants to the call, namely associations (federations, networks, coordinations, etc.) that operate in the field of youth work and for youth, as well as local and regional self-government units and their project partners (associations, federations, networks, coordinations of associations, public institutions, and foundations). Under this call, focused on increasing social inclusion of youth, projects will be financed that will contribute to the quality implementation of youth leisure time, increasing youth awareness, and providing counseling services on topics relevant to youth, as well as preventing violence among youth, improving the development of social skills and competencies that contribute to competitiveness in the labor market and social inclusion of youth, as well as encouraging active participation of youth in society.
ZAGREB – On the agenda of the first session of the Committee for Naming Settlements, Streets, and Squares of the Zagreb City Assembly will be the proposal of the Mayor of Zagreb Milan Bandić and the Club of City Representatives Independents for Croatia, to rename Marshal Tito Square to Republic of Croatia Square (10 AM, Old City Hall, Hall D, St. Cyril and Methodius Street 5).
VELIKI BUKOVEC – The Minister of Construction and Spatial Planning Predrag Štromar and the acting director of the Environmental Protection and Energy Efficiency Fund Ljubomir Majdandžić will sign Contracts for the allocation of non-repayable funds with users as part of the Call “Energy Renovation of Buildings and Use of Renewable Energy Sources in Public Institutions Engaged in Education” (9 AM, Veliki Bukovec Primary School, Dravska Street 42). These are projects for the Energy Renovation of the building of OŠ Franje Serta at Ljudevita Gaja 15, Bednja, Energy Renovation of the building of the Novi Marof Secondary School at Zagorska 22, Novi Marof, and Energy Renovation of the building of Veliki Bukovec Primary School at Dravska Street 42, Veliki Bukovec. The Deputy Prefect of Varaždin County Tomislav Paljak will also attend the event.
